解析当前页面url,获取查询字符串参数

来源:互联网 发布:神机妙算算量软件 编辑:程序博客网 时间:2024/05/20 18:49
// 解析urlfunction getQueryStringArgs(){  var qs = (location.search.length>0?location.search.substring(1):"");  var args = {};  var items = qs.length?qs.split("&"):[];  var item = null;  var name = null;  var value = null;  len = items.length;  for (var i = 0; i < len; i++) {    item = items[i].split("=");    name = decodeURIComponent(item[0]);    value = decodeURIComponent(item[1]);    if (name.length) {      args[name] = value;    }  }  return args;}



例如 当前url 为  http://write.blog.csdn.net/postedit?ref=toolbar&num=10&p=hu

var  args = getQueryStringArgs();

args["ref"]    //   toolbar

args["num"]   //   10

args["p"]     //  hu

0 0
原创粉丝点击